4000000000
您的位置:首页>>快连vip>>正文

全国免费服务热线

4000000000

Google App Engine,开启简易高效VPN服务新时代

时间:2024-11-14 作者:南风 点击:1次

信息摘要:

Google App Engine凭借其灵活性和易用性,成为构建简易高效VPN服务的新选择。它支持多种编程语言,可快速部署,助力企业轻松搭建安全可靠的VPN解决方案,提高网络访问速度和稳定性。...

Google App Engine凭借其灵活性和易用性,成为构建简易高效VPN服务的新选择。它支持多种编程语言,可快速部署,助力企业轻松搭建安全可靠的VPN解决方案,提高网络访问速度和稳定性。
  1. Google App Engine简介

Google App Engine,开启简易高效VPN服务新时代,Google App Engine示意图,google app engine架设vpn,VPN服,VPN的,at,第1张

在互联网的广泛应用下,公众对网络隐私和安全的关注持续升温,VPN(Virtual Private Network,虚拟私人网络)作为维护网络安全的重要工具,越来越受到用户的青睐,传统的VPN服务往往涉及复杂的设置和较高的成本,本文将深入探讨如何利用Google App Engine,轻松搭建一个既简便又高效的VPN服务解决方案。

Google App Engine简介

Google App Engine(简称GAE)是Google提供的一项云计算服务,它允许用户轻松创建、部署和管理应用程序,GAE支持多种编程语言,包括Java、Python、PHP等,并提供了自动扩展、负载均衡、数据库存储等功能,极大简化了应用程序的开发与部署流程。

利用Google App Engine搭建VPN的优势

  • 成本效益:GAE提供免费的基础服务额度,对于小规模用户来说,无需承担高昂的服务器费用。
  • 部署便捷:GAE的部署过程简单快速,只需编写相应的代码,即可迅速将VPN服务上线。
  • 自动扩展:GAE会根据用户访问量自动调整资源,确保VPN服务的稳定性和高效性。
  • 安全保障:GAE提供多层安全防护措施,包括HTTPS加密和防火墙等,有效保障用户数据安全。
  • 跨平台兼容:GAE支持多种编程语言,用户可根据个人偏好选择合适的开发语言。

利用Google App Engine搭建VPN的步骤

  1. 注册Google App Engine账号:用户需在Google Cloud Console上注册一个账号,注册成功后登录,并创建一个新的项目。
  2. 选择编程语言和框架:GAE支持多种编程语言和框架,用户可根据需求选择合适的语言和框架。
  3. 编写VPN服务代码:以下是一个基于Python的简单VPN服务示例代码:

    ```python

    from flask import Flask, request, jsonify

    import requests

    app = Flask(__name__)

    @app.route('/vpn', methods=['POST'])

    def vpn():

    data = request.json

    url = data['url']

    response = requests.get(url)

    return jsonify({'result': response.text})

    if __name__ == '__main__':

    app.run()

    ```

  4. 部署VPN服务:在GAE项目中,选择“Deployments”选项,点击“Create deployment”按钮,填写相关信息,如版本号、运行环境等,然后点击“Deploy”按钮。
  5. 获取VPN服务地址:部署成功后,在“Deployments”选项中,即可找到VPN服务的地址,用户可以通过该地址访问VPN服务。

利用Google App Engine搭建VPN服务,不仅成本低廉,部署简便,而且易于维护,通过以上步骤,用户可以轻松构建一个高效、便捷的VPN服务,在实际应用中,用户可能需要根据具体需求对VPN服务进行优化和调整,本文旨在为您提供搭建VPN服务的指导,希望对您有所帮助。

请先 登录 再评论,若不是会员请先 注册